As tensions between China and Japan increase, including over the
disputed islands in the East China Sea, Japan has adopted under
Prime Minister Abe a new security posture. This involves,
internally, adapting Japan's constitutional position on defence
and, externally, building stronger international relationships in
the Asia-Pacific region and more widely. This book presents a
comprehensive analysis of these developments. It shows how trust
and co-operation with the United States, the only partner with
which Japan has a formal alliance, is being rebuilt, discusses how
other relationships, both on security and on wider issues, are
being formed, in the region and with European countries and the EU,
with the relationships with India and Australia being of particular
importance, and concludes by assessing the likely impact on the
region of Japan's changing posture and new relationships.
